Zuckerberg’s Choice: A Manual Cadillac CT5-V Blackwing
Self-made billionaire, Mark Zuckerberg, eschews chauffeured rides, preferring the thrill of driving himself. His love for manual transmissions led him to purchase a Cadillac CT5-V Blackwing. “I really like driving manual transmission cars,” Zuckerberg shared, expressing his passion for stick shifts.
The CT5-V Blackwing boasts a supercharged 6.2-liter V8 engine, delivering 668 horsepower and 659 pound-feet of torque. This powerhouse propels the sedan from 0 to 60 mph in a mere 3.4 seconds, reaching a top speed of 200 mph.

A Porsche Minivan?
For family outings when the helicopter remains grounded, the Zuckerbergs utilize a custom Porsche minivan. This unique vehicle was designed by Zuckerberg himself and built by West Coast Customs. “I designed her this Porsche minivan. I like cars, but I am not going to design a supercar for myself; I am going to design a minivan for my wife,” he explained, highlighting his thoughtful gift for his wife, Priscilla.
